30 /* Define error types */
32 /**
33 * @brief Status codes returned from wbc functions
34 **/
36 enum _wbcErrType {
37 WBC_ERR_SUCCESS = 0, /**< Successful completion **/
38 WBC_ERR_NOT_IMPLEMENTED,/**< Function not implemented **/
39 WBC_ERR_UNKNOWN_FAILURE,/**< General failure **/
40 WBC_ERR_NO_MEMORY, /**< Memory allocation error **/
41 WBC_ERR_INVALID_SID, /**< Invalid SID format **/
42 WBC_ERR_INVALID_PARAM, /**< An Invalid parameter was supplied **/
43 WBC_ERR_WINBIND_NOT_AVAILABLE, /**< Winbind daemon is not available **/
44 WBC_ERR_DOMAIN_NOT_FOUND, /**< Domain is not trusted or cannot be found **/
45 WBC_ERR_INVALID_RESPONSE, /**< Winbind returned an invalid response **/
46 WBC_ERR_NSS_ERROR, /**< NSS_STATUS error **/
47 WBC_ERR_AUTH_ERROR, /**< Authentication failed **/
48 WBC_ERR_UNKNOWN_USER, /**< User account cannot be found */
49 WBC_ERR_UNKNOWN_GROUP, /**< Group account cannot be found */
50 WBC_ERR_PWD_CHANGE_FAILED /**< Password Change has failed */
53 typedef enum _wbcErrType wbcErr;
55 #define WBC_ERROR_IS_OK(x) ((x) == WBC_ERR_SUCCESS)
57 const char *wbcErrorString(wbcErr error);
59 /**
60 * @brief Some useful details about the wbclient library
62 * 0.1: Initial version
63 * 0.2: Added wbcRemoveUidMapping()
64 * Added wbcRemoveGidMapping()
65 * 0.3: Added wbcGetpwsid()
66 * Added wbcGetSidAliases()
67 * 0.4: Added wbcSidTypeString()
68 * 0.5: Added wbcChangeTrustCredentials()
69 * 0.6: Made struct wbcInterfaceDetails char* members non-const
70 * 0.7: Added wbcSidToStringBuf()
71 * 0.8: Added wbcSidsToUnixIds() and wbcLookupSids()
72 * 0.9: Added support for WBC_ID_TYPE_BOTH
73 * 0.10: Added wbcPingDc2()
74 * 0.11: Extended wbcAuthenticateUserEx to provide PAC parsing
75 * 0.12: Added wbcCtxCreate and friends
76 * 0.13: Added wbcCtxUnixIdsToSids and wbcUnixIdsToSids
77 * 0.14: Added "authoritative" to wbcAuthErrorInfo
78 * Added WBC_SID_NAME_LABEL
79 * 0.15: Added wbcSetClientProcessName()
80 **/

406 /* wbcAuthUserInfo->acct_flags */
408 #define WBC_ACB_DISABLED 0x00000001 /* 1 User account disabled */
409 #define WBC_ACB_HOMDIRREQ 0x00000002 /* 1 Home directory required */
410 #define WBC_ACB_PWNOTREQ 0x00000004 /* 1 User password not required */
411 #define WBC_ACB_TEMPDUP 0x00000008 /* 1 Temporary duplicate account */
412 #define WBC_ACB_NORMAL 0x00000010 /* 1 Normal user account */
413 #define WBC_ACB_MNS 0x00000020 /* 1 MNS logon user account */
414 #define WBC_ACB_DOMTRUST 0x00000040 /* 1 Interdomain trust account */
415 #define WBC_ACB_WSTRUST 0x00000080 /* 1 Workstation trust account */
416 #define WBC_ACB_SVRTRUST 0x00000100 /* 1 Server trust account */
417 #define WBC_ACB_PWNOEXP 0x00000200 /* 1 User password does not expire */
418 #define WBC_ACB_AUTOLOCK 0x00000400 /* 1 Account auto locked */
419 #define WBC_ACB_ENC_TXT_PWD_ALLOWED 0x00000800 /* 1 Encryped text password is allowed */
420 #define WBC_ACB_SMARTCARD_REQUIRED 0x00001000 /* 1 Smart Card required */
421 #define WBC_ACB_TRUSTED_FOR_DELEGATION 0x00002000 /* 1 Trusted for Delegation */
422 #define WBC_ACB_NOT_DELEGATED 0x00004000 /* 1 Not delegated */
423 #define WBC_ACB_USE_DES_KEY_ONLY 0x00008000 /* 1 Use DES key only */
424 #define WBC_ACB_DONT_REQUIRE_PREAUTH 0x00010000 /* 1 Preauth not required */
425 #define WBC_ACB_PW_EXPIRED 0x00020000 /* 1 Password Expired */
426 #define WBC_ACB_NO_AUTH_DATA_REQD 0x00080000 /* 1 = No authorization data required */

2056 * @brief Set the name of the process which call wbclient.
2058 * By default wbclient will figure out the process name. This should just be
2059 * used in special cases like pam modules or similar. Only alpha numeric
2060 * chars in ASCII are allowed.
2062 * This function should only be called once!
2064 * @param[in] name The process name to set.
2066 void wbcSetClientProcessName(const char *name);
